This simple and delicious spaghetti squash recipe guides you through roasting the squash to tender perfection, then shredding it into spaghetti-like strands. It's a healthy, low-carb alternative to pasta that’s easy to prepare and pairs well with a variety of sauces.

Instructions
Preheat your oven to 400°F (204°C) to ensure it reaches the right temperature for roasting the squash evenly.
Using a sharp knife, carefully slice the spaghetti squash into 1 1/2 inch thick rounds. If slicing is difficult, microwave the whole squash for 30-60 seconds to soften the exterior slightly.
Use a spoon or melon baller to scoop out the seeds from each squash round, discarding or saving them as desired.
Place the squash rounds on a baking sheet and brush them with olive oil. Season generously with sea salt and black pepper to enhance the flavor.
Roast the squash in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, or until the flesh is tender and easily pierced with a fork.
Remove the baking sheet from the oven and allow the squash rounds to cool slightly until safe to handle.
Using a fork, gently scrape the flesh of the squash to separate it into long, spaghetti-like strands.
Serve the spaghetti squash warm as a base for your favorite sauces, toppings, or enjoy it plain.
